Can I Use Canva Images on My Blog or Website?

Yes, you can definitely use Canva images on your blog or website. In fact, Canva is a great resource for finding high-quality, royalty-free images that you can use for free. Altered Images:

If your blog theme is wider than 800 pixels, you’ll need to export your featured image at a higher resolution so it doesn’t become blurry.Then, you’d have to change it into a distinct composition as part of the process:

This is unique because you’ve altered a stock image by incorporating it into a distinct blog-specific featured image. “You’re producing something distinctive when you utilize material in a design or a composition,” Canva’s licensing guidelines continue. “There are very few limitations on what you may do with them after that. Are Canva Images Copyright-Free??

Yes, all Canva images are copyright-free. This means that you can use them for any purpose, commercial or non-commercial, without having to get permission from the artist or pay a fee. However, if you are a free user, you must give credit to the artist and link back to the original image (this is called attribution). Pro users do not need to provide attribution.

How Many Times Can I Use a Canva Image?

There is no limit to how many times you can use a Canva image. You can use it as many times as you like, for any purpose, commercial or non-commercial. However, if you are a free user, you must give credit to the artist and link back to the original image (this is called attribution). Pro users do not need to provide attribution.
